Anyone use for horseback hunts?

Beyond about October 15 pac boots are about all I use on horseback hunts. About the only way to stay warm for me. Just not hiking enough to generate heat, and in insulated boots, sweat accumulates over the days. At least with a pac boot you can pull them apart and get them dry. Very tough to dry out a 800 gm+ Thinsulate boot that has gore tex liner

Hey Roksliders, I just picked up my first pair of Pac Boots this week. I decided to go with Hoffman Mountaineers. I'm taking them with me on my Colorado deer hunt next week and then plan to use them for some winter predator hunting I have planned.

My feet are size 9 1/2 and I ordered size 9 per their direction. The boots seem to have plenty of room, even with thick winter socks. They are obviously bulky and heavy compared to my hunting boots but that's okay if they keep me comfortable longer while glassing in the cold.
